加入收藏 | 设为首页 | 会员中心 | 我要投稿 百科站长网 (https://www.baikewang.com.cn/)- AI硬件、建站、图像技术、AI行业应用、智能营销!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android开发:MSSQL数据集成与索引优化指南

发布时间:2026-02-09 14:27:31 所属栏目:MsSql教程 来源:DaWei
导读:  在Android开发中,集成MSSQL数据库通常涉及网络请求和数据解析。为了实现这一目标,开发者需要使用合适的库,如OkHttp或Retrofit进行HTTP通信,并通过JSON或XML格式传输数据。MSSQL数据库本身不直接支持与Androi

  在Android开发中,集成MSSQL数据库通常涉及网络请求和数据解析。为了实现这一目标,开发者需要使用合适的库,如OkHttp或Retrofit进行HTTP通信,并通过JSON或XML格式传输数据。MSSQL数据库本身不直接支持与Android设备的连接,因此必须通过后端API作为中介。


  在设计数据接口时,应确保返回的数据结构清晰且易于解析。例如,使用RESTful API返回JSON格式的数据,可以简化Android端的处理流程。同时,需注意网络权限配置,确保AndroidManifest.xml中包含互联网访问权限。


  索引优化是提升MSSQL查询性能的关键。合理创建索引可以显著减少查询时间,尤其是在频繁查询的字段上。但过多的索引会影响写入性能,因此需要在读写之间找到平衡点。建议对WHERE、JOIN和ORDER BY子句中的字段建立索引。


  除了索引,查询语句的优化同样重要。避免使用SELECT ,而是指定所需字段,减少数据传输量。同时,合理使用JOIN操作,避免不必要的表连接,有助于提高执行效率。


  在Android端,可采用异步任务(如AsyncTask或协程)处理数据加载,防止主线程阻塞。结合缓存机制,如使用Room数据库存储部分数据,可以减少对MSSQL的频繁访问,提升用户体验。


2026AI生成的视觉方案,仅供参考

  定期监控MSSQL的性能指标,如查询执行计划和索引碎片率,有助于发现潜在问题并及时调整。通过持续优化数据库结构和查询逻辑,能够有效提升整体系统的稳定性和响应速度。

(编辑:百科站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章